To begin with this particular recipe, we must first prepare a few components. You can cook kadha using 10 ingredients and 4 steps. Here is how you can achieve it.

The ingredients needed to make Kadha:
  1. Get Water
  2. Take Black peppercorns
  3. Get Black cardamom
  4. Take Cardamom green
  5. Take Sugar
  6. Get Cinnamon
  7. Take Cloves
  8. Take Fresh ginger
  9. Take tulsi
  10. Take Tea

Instructions to make Kadha:
  1. To make kadha put a pan on the gas add two cup water boil it.
  2. On the other side, we crushed all the spices as black pepper corns, black cardamom, green cardamom, cinnamon cloves ginger tulsi & add all in the boil water cooked it 3 to 5 minute
  3. Then add 2 cup sugar & 1/2 tea & cooled it 5 minute
  4. Then strain the mixture using a strainer in a cup. Now your kadha is ready.
